Project
|
| |
|
 |
|
PART ONE:
Two weeks (2X 45-60 minute sessions) working through Kahootz tutorials and 'playing'. Students worked in loose pairs, taking turns at mouse control.
PART TWO:
Every day for 7 consecutive days (7 X 45-60 minutes) - a competition deadline loomed. Students worked in pairs on the In Kahootz with Saving Freshwater project.

Rationale
|
| |
|
 |
- Students are familiar with the likes of PlayStation and X-box, so are immediately comfortable with and excited by Kahootz - even with no pre-experience. Kahootz is fun, engaging, promotes problem solving and is student-centred.
- Students learn well through visual stimulus, play and verbalizing.
- Students can produce some amazing results when given a clear, simple purpose.
In pairs, the students were challenged to:
|
 |
|
 |
Learn all they could about using Kahootz through tutorials and play, then.
|
 |
Create a 30 second commercial about saving freshwater, guided by the verses of a rap provided for them.
|
 |
| |
A hybrid Xpression using the best scenes, as voted by the students,
was rendered into AVI files and burned onto DVD along with sound files of students rapping the rap.
The DVD was:
|
 |
Entered into a competition.
|
 |
Used by the students in student-run, whole-school Watercare Education Program.

Student Tasks
|
| |
|
 |
|
 |
Create an 8 scene Xpression, which runs exactly for 30 seconds.
|
 |
Each scene must reflect accurately the sense of each verse in a 30 second rap about how water can be better saved at work, rest and play.
|
 |
| |
Scene 1:
|
 |
Introduction: The problem made clear eg. people demonstrating.
|
| |
Scene 2:
|
 |
Wasting water with hoses and showers. |
| |
Scene 3:
|
 |
The consequence of that action.
|
| |
Scene 4:
|
 |
Misunderstanding that a little rainfall = ample freshwater supplies.
|
| |
Scene 5:
|
 |
The consequences of that action.
|
| |
Scene 6:
|
 |
Wasting water when we play eg water fights, in the pool…
|
| |
Scene 7:
|
 |
The consequences of that action.
|
| |
Scene 8:
|
 |
Conclusion: The solution eg. slogans such as Be Waterwise.

Involvement for Xpression Participant
|
| |
|
 |
|
 |
Select appropriate Kahootz 'World'. |
 |
 |
Choose appropriate 'Objects' or create them as needs be. |
 |
Use tools, swatches, animations and keypoints to best convey the rap's message. |
 |
 |
View each other's Xpressions - one message can be presented successfully, differently. |
 |
 |
Determine which students' individual scenes best conveyed the message of each verse. |
 |
 |
Create a hybrid Expression composed of "best scenes". |
 |
Students record rap for overlay overlaid. |
 |
Create DVD of Expression + Rap (not done by students). |

Learning Outcomes for Student Creator
|
| |
|
| |
|
 |
Exploring design and presentation concepts - matching visuals with 'lyrics'.
|
 |
Developing skills in the creation and manipulation of digital art.
|
 |
Experimenting with various types of animation techniques.
|
 |
Objects required enlarging or reducing, introducing ideas of multiplication and ratio.
|
 |
 |
Creating objects.

Collaborative Potential
|
| |
|
| |
|
 |
As part of our Watercare Education Program, the year 6 students ran a 2-week In Kahootz with Saving Freshwater competition for students from year 3 - 7.
Entries had to submit online. They were to be one scene conveying clearly a message about better watercare around the home.
Some entrants worked on the project during class time with their teachers.
All entrants were also invited to book in for lunchtime tutorials run by year 6 students in our school computer lab - every day over 2 weeks. They could book 2 sessions a week.
